Can Synthetic Text Help Clinical Named Entity Recognition? A Study of Electronic Health Records in French (2023.eacl-main)

| Challenge: | In sensitive domains, the sharing of corpora is restricted due to confidentiality, copyrights or trade secrets. |
| Approach: | They use auto-regressive neural models to generate a clinical case corpus annotated with clinical entities and evaluate it for a named entity recognition task. |
| Outcome: | The proposed model can produce clinical case corpus annotated with clinical entities while maintaining confidentiality. |
A Benchmark Corpus for the Detection of Automatically Generated Text in Academic Publications (2022.lrec-1)

| Challenge: | Automated text generation has achieved performance levels that make the generated text almost indistinguishable from those written by humans. |
| Approach: | They propose to use a completely synthetic dataset and a partial text substitution dataset to evaluate the quality of the generated research content. |
| Outcome: | The proposed datasets compare the generated texts to aligned original texts using fluency metrics such as BLEU and ROUGE. |
